Seung Bin Kim is a scholar working on Materials Chemistry, Electronic, Optical and Magnetic Materials and Electrical and Electronic Engineering. According to data from OpenAlex, Seung Bin Kim has authored 67 papers receiving a total of 3.5k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Materials Chemistry, 16 papers in Electronic, Optical and Magnetic Materials and 14 papers in Electrical and Electronic Engineering. Recurrent topics in Seung Bin Kim’s work include Liquid Crystal Research Advancements (12 papers), Spectroscopy and Chemometric Analyses (10 papers) and Material Dynamics and Properties (10 papers). Seung Bin Kim is often cited by papers focused on Liquid Crystal Research Advancements (12 papers), Spectroscopy and Chemometric Analyses (10 papers) and Material Dynamics and Properties (10 papers). Seung Bin Kim collaborates with scholars based in South Korea, United States and Japan. Seung Bin Kim's co-authors include Young Mee Jung, Hyun Chul Choi, Hyeon Suk Shin, Boknam Chae, Seung Woo Lee, Moonhor Ree, Isao Noda, Hyun Jung Yang, Mu Sang Lee and Nayoun Won and has published in prestigious journals such as Journal of the American Chemical Society, Chemistry of Materials and Analytical Chemistry.
